Comprehending Legacy Systems
Tradition systems are typically defined as out-of-date computing software and hardware that are still in usage, despite the availability of newer technology. These systems can be deeply deep-rooted in a company's operations, making them challenging to replace. According to a report by the International Data Corporation (IDC), nearly 70% of IT spending plans are still assigned to preserving tradition systems, which hinders development and agility.
The disadvantages of tradition systems are manifold. They can lead to increased functional costs, reduced efficiency, and an absence of flexibility in responding to market changes. Additionally, as businesses grow, these out-of-date systems can become bottlenecks, avoiding scalability and preventing the ability to leverage data successfully.
The Shift to Agile IT Infrastructure
Agile IT infrastructure is identified by its flexibility, scalability, and responsiveness to change. It permits organizations to adapt rapidly to market needs and technological advancements. A study carried out by McKinsey & Business discovered that organizations that adopt nimble practices can improve their time-to-market by up to 50%, significantly boosting their one-upmanship.
Transitioning to a nimble infrastructure typically involves a number of key parts:
Cloud Computing: Accepting cloud technology is fundamental in improving IT infrastructure. According to Gartner, the worldwide public cloud services market is predicted to grow to $623.3 billion by 2023. Cloud services provide scalability, cost-efficiency, and boosted partnership, allowing businesses to react to altering demands promptly.
Microservices Architecture: This technique breaks down applications into smaller, independent services that can be established, deployed, and scaled individually. A research study by the Cloud Native Computing Foundation (CNCF) revealed that organizations adopting microservices architecture report a 20% boost in deployment frequency and a 30% improvement in preparation for changes.
DevOps Practices: Integrating development and operations groups fosters a culture of partnership and continuous enhancement. Data-Driven Choice Making: Modernizing IT infrastructure is insufficient without leveraging data analytics. Businesses that use data analytics effectively can accomplish a 5-6% boost in productivity, as reported by McKinsey. This shift makes it possible for companies to make informed choices, anticipate market patterns, and improve consumer experiences.

Case Research Studies in Modernization
Numerous companies have actually effectively transitioned from legacy systems to nimble infrastructures, showcasing the advantages of modernization.
General Electric (GE): GE carried out a cloud-based solution that permitted them to improve operations and enhance data accessibility. By adopting agile practices, GE minimized the time it required to develop brand-new items and services, resulting in a significant increase in market responsiveness.
Netflix: Initially built on a monolithic architecture, Netflix transitioned to microservices, enabling them to scale quickly and innovate constantly. This shift permitted Netflix to deploy changes to its platform every couple of seconds, boosting user experience and complete satisfaction.
Target: Target's modernization efforts included a thorough overhaul of its IT infrastructure, focusing on cloud computing and data analytics. As a result, the business improved its inventory management and customer engagement methods, causing increased sales and customer loyalty.
Challenges in the Transition
While the advantages of improving IT infrastructure are clear, companies might deal with obstacles during the transition. Resistance to change, absence of skilled personnel, and spending plan restrictions can prevent development. A report by Deloitte found that 70% of digital changes stop working, typically due to inadequate modification management and leadership assistance.
To mitigate these difficulties, companies must prioritize:
Modification Management: Developing a robust change management method is essential. This includes appealing stakeholders, communicating the advantages of modernization, and offering training and support to employees.
Financial investment in Skill: Organizations needs to purchase upskilling their workforce to guarantee they have the essential abilities to operate in a nimble environment. Partnering with business and technology consulting firms can offer access to competence and training resources.
Iterative Approach: Instead of trying a total overhaul, organizations can adopt an iterative method to modernization. This permits gradual execution, reducing interruption and enabling constant feedback and enhancement.
